Understanding the Industry Context
With global online gambling revenue surpassing $70 billion in 2023, the sector faces mounting regulatory scrutiny and societal calls for player protection. Responsible gambling (RG) initiatives are no longer ancillary offerings but central to operational models, influencing licensing, compliance, and reputation management.
In this context, platforms that prioritize a transparent, welcoming experience set themselves apart. For instance, modern online casinos leverage data analytics to tailor onboarding experiences and employ sophisticated tools such as self-exclusion options, deposit limits, and real-time monitoring to mitigate harm.

Key Elements of an Effective Player Onboarding Strategy
| Component | Purpose | Industry Example |
|---|---|---|
| Clear Communication of Rules | Sets expectations and reduces misunderstandings | Detailed FAQs and Terms & Conditions at sign-up |
| Self-Assessment Tools | Helps players evaluate their gambling behavior | Pre-commitment checks during registration |
| Welcome Bonuses with Responsible Features | Engages users while promoting safety | Bonuses that include deposit limits or time restrictions |
| Educational Content | Increases awareness about gambling risks | Interactive tutorials and responsible gaming tips |
Technological Innovations Supporting Responsible Onboarding
Building on industry benchmarks, advanced technologies like artificial intelligence and machine learning are transforming player onboarding. These systems enable real-time risk detection, prompting intervention if gambling patterns suggest potential harm. As an illustrative case, some operators embed automatic alerts when players approach self-imposed limits or show signs of distress.
The integration of these innovations aligns with regulatory frameworks that demand proactive, non-intrusive measures for vulnerable players, elevating the industry’s commitment to ethical gaming standards.
